Output 68c0324a5882ac61e757d51bd2cf72681e767c1bc2f4a64008bba3c872f6e151:2

value
320000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d67ffe5b0d9735f5ac99dd92624eb5455f586bc OP_EQUAL
address
3G3JbgPVnSdhAqLBdSHkikYyV8dCoN9UGe
transaction
68c0324a5882ac61e757d51bd2cf72681e767c1bc2f4a64008bba3c872f6e151
spent
true